What are the typical daily responsibilities of a card game dealer?

As a Card Game Dealer, your daily duties typically include shuffling and dealing cards, enforcing game rules, managing bets and payouts, and maintaining the pace and integrity of the game. You are responsible for providing a fair and enjoyable experience for players, resolving disputes courteously, and collaborating closely with casino supervisors and security staff. Depending on the casino, you may rotate between tables and manage various card games throughout your shift. Success in this role also comes from building rapport with players while ensuring strict adherence to gaming regulations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the card game position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Card Game Dealer, you need a strong understanding of card game rules, quick mental math skills, and a high level of integrity, typically supported by on-the-job training or certification from a gaming commission. Familiarity with casino management systems and handling gaming equipment is essential. Exceptional interpersonal skills, patience, and the ability to remain composed under pressure are vital soft skills. These abilities ensure smooth gameplay, compliance with regulations, and a positive experience for both players and the gaming establishment.

What will you work on?
As the Game Developer for Hellbreak TCG, you will analyze card designs and manage our external playtest networks to ensure the game remains balanced, engaging, and mechanically sound. You will translate qualitative playtest data into actionable design refinements and ensure our dark horror themes are elegantly integrated into airtight physical rules.
This is an on going contract opportunity. 4 days in office
How will you create impact?
  • Review card files and mechanical submissions with game designers to provide analytical feedback on card effects, mechanical complexity, and overall set architecture.
  • Source, vet, and manage a dedicated network of external playtesters and community alpha/beta groups.
  • Gather, synthesize, and interpret qualitative feedback and quantitative match data from playtests to address dominant strategies and power creep.
  • Collaborate with designers to translate narrative horror elements into elegant analog rules that evoke psychological tension and thematic gameplay.
  • Act as the primary technical liaison for external co-development partners, ensuring all deliverables meet design, balancing, and documentation standards.

What are your skills and experience?
  • Proven track record in tabletop game development, set design, or technical editing within trading card games or systems-heavy board games.
  • Profound structural understanding of physical trading card game systems and the competitive landscape.
  • Strong ability to model game economies, track card asset lists, and analyze set distribution.
  • Exceptional technical writing skills with a focus on logic, syntax, and clarity for crafting airtight physical rules and card text.
  • Specialized knowledge of the aesthetics and history of the horror genre.
